Remote Project Manager - Water Industry
Veolia North America | Chicago, IL | Apr 09
Veolia Group is a global leader in environmental services, operating across all five continents with nearly 218,000 employees. Specializing in water, energy, and waste management, Veolia Group designs and implements innovative solutions for...